Transaction 66d8e134cdb9828b59aaecf81cb406f81e8148965dae07cea23b88033b5772c6
1 Input
1 Output
-
66d8e134cdb9828b59aaecf81cb406f81e8148965dae07cea23b88033b5772c6:0
- value
- 80265
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1e27fbd26eac5ec6928750836f3602e14c0ab00 OP_EQUAL
- address
- 3Pjz7CYkRGs9LCSfjU7yzuaHAgyM8rfEqe